SCOOCH Hierarchs Participate in the Consecration of St. Mark’s Syriac Orthodox Cathedral


Paramus, NJ – At the kind invitation of the former president of the Standing Conference of Oriental Orthodox Churches (SCOOCH) – His Holiness Mor Ignatius Aphrem II, Patriarch of Antioch and all the East – several bishops of SCOOCH were blessed to participate in the consecration of St. Mark’s Syriac Orthodox Cathedral last Friday, May 17, 2019. In addition to His Holiness’ own bishops – among them SCOOCH members H.E. Mor Dionysios John Kawak, H.E. Mor Titus Yeldho, and H.E. Mor Silvanos Ayoub – H.G. Anba David, Coptic Orthodox Bishop of the Diocese of New York & New England, and H.G. Abune Makarios, Bishop of the Eritrean Orthodox Diocese of America, took part in the prayers. Also participating in the consecration was another former SCOOCH president, H.E. Archbishop Khajag Barsamian, formerly the Primate of the Eastern Diocese of the Armenian Church and presently the Armenian Church’s legate to Rome.

On Sunday, May 19, 2019, Abune Makarios returned to St. Mark’s along with Archbishop Khajag’s successor as the Primate of the Armenian Eastern Diocese, the newly appointed H.G. Bishop Daniel, to join His Holiness Mor Ignatius Aphrem II in a Hierarchical Divine Liturgy during which subdeacons and readers were ordained for the Syriac Archdiocese.
